Data integration is more than moving data from source to target systems. It is part of the greater data value chain that transforms raw source data into information and actionable insights that help drive decisions and operational processes. Like any other value chain, each step in the process moves the data one step closer to consumption by transforming it in ways that add value to the end user. Data in motion is one of the best times to perform integration.  If you are going to merge data at rest, you either have to copy data into a merged table, or you create views and don’t really integrate the Data until later in the data value chain – your options are limited.  When you are moving data, you have the opportunity to transform it – changing data structures, summarizing, categorizing, and aggregating data from different sources.  Each time data moves, you should be seeking ways to make it even more valuable for your organization.
